Graham Coxon to support The Libertines at British Summertime Festival
As previously reported, The Libertines are set to reunite (once again) for a headline show at London’s Hyde Park this summer. With the likes of The Pogues, Spiritualized and more on the same bill, Blur’s Graham Coxon has been newly added too.
Part of this year’s British Summertime Festival will take place on 5 July, Black Sabbath (4 July), McBusted (6 July), Neil Young (12 July) and Tom Jones (13 July) are also booked for shows across the series.
The Libertines’ line-up will be completed by Wolf Alice, Swim Deep, Maximo Park, The Enemy, Reverend and The Makers, I Am Kloot, The View, Darlia, The Rifles, Cuckoolander, Brownbear, Raglans, The Twang, Slaves, The Jacques, Franko Fraize and Lois & The Love.
